Roger Daltrey and Kenney Jones of the Who rock group visit Chiswick Family Rescue Home
The group announced they are to give a Charity Concert at Londons Rainbow Theatre in aid of the home, run by Erin Pizzey for battered wives and children.
16th December 1980

Alisdair MacDonald
Daily Mirror
